The global Tungsten Metal Powder market was valued at USD 1,234.5 million in 2022 and is projected to reach USD 1,856.7 million by 2029, growing at a Compound Annual Growth Rate (CAGR) of 5.9% during the forecast period (2023–2029). This growth is being driven by surging demand in cemented carbides for cutting tools, expanding applications in electronics and aerospace components, and the rising need for high-performance alloys in automotive and defense sectors. The influence of COVID-19 and the Russia-Ukraine War were considered while estimating market sizes.

🔟 1. Jiangxi Tungsten Holding Group Co., Ltd.

Headquarters: Ganzhou, Jiangxi Province, China
Key Offering: Fine tungsten powder (1-10μm), ultra-fine powder (up to 1μm), and APT-derived powders

Jiangxi Tungsten Holding Group stands as one of the world’s largest tungsten producers, controlling significant mining operations and downstream processing facilities. The company supplies high-purity tungsten metal powder to industries ranging from cemented carbide tool manufacturers to aerospace component fabricators. With a vertically integrated model, it ensures consistent quality and supply, particularly for the Asian market where demand for precision tools is booming. Furthermore, their focus on R&D has led to advancements in nano-scale powders suitable for 3D printing applications in additive manufacturing.

Sustainability and Innovation Initiatives:

  • Implementation of closed-loop water recycling in mining to reduce environmental impact

  • Investment in AI-driven powder production for uniform particle distribution

  • Commitment to carbon-neutral operations by 2040 through renewable energy adoption in facilities

9️⃣ 2. China Molybdenum Co., Ltd.

Headquarters: Luoyang, Henan Province, China
Key Offering: Coarse and medium tungsten powders (10-50μm), alloyed tungsten powders

China Molybdenum, a diversified mining giant, has carved out a substantial role in the tungsten metal powder sector through strategic acquisitions of tungsten assets worldwide. Their powder products are widely used in steel alloying and mill products, supporting the global push for stronger, more durable materials in construction and automotive sectors. Because of their global footprint, including operations in Australia and Brazil, they mitigate supply risks associated with geopolitical tensions, ensuring reliable delivery to international clients.

Sustainability and Innovation Initiatives:

  • Development of tungsten recycling programs to recover powder from scrap, promoting circular economy principles

  • Partnerships with universities for research into tungsten-based nanomaterials for electronics


8️⃣ 3. Xiamen Tungsten Corporation

Headquarters: Xiamen, Fujian Province, China
Key Offering: High-purity tungsten powder, spherical powders for thermal spraying

Xiamen Tungsten excels in producing specialized tungsten metal powders tailored for high-tech applications like semiconductors and medical devices. Their commitment to ultra-high purity levels, often exceeding 99.99%, makes them a preferred supplier for electronics manufacturers seeking reliable conductive materials. However, as global supply chains face scrutiny over ethical sourcing, the company has ramped up transparency in its procurement processes to meet international standards.

Sustainability and Innovation Initiatives:

  • Adoption of green chemistry in powder reduction processes to minimize emissions

  • Expansion of production capacity for fine powders to meet growing 5G infrastructure demands

6️⃣ 5. Global Tungsten & Powders Corp.

Headquarters: Towanda, Pennsylvania, USA
Key Offering: Thermal spray powders, fine and ultra-fine tungsten powders

Global Tungsten & Powders, a subsidiary of Plansee Group, brings American innovation to the tungsten arena with expertise in advanced powder metallurgy. Serving defense, aerospace, and oil & gas sectors, their powders enhance wear resistance in turbine blades and drilling tools. Their North American base allows quick response to U.S. regulatory requirements, including ITAR compliance for military applications.

Sustainability and Innovation Initiatives:

  • Utilization of hydrogen reduction methods for lower-carbon powder production

  • Collaborations with NASA on tungsten alloys for space exploration


5️⃣ 6. H.C. Starck Tungsten GmbH

Headquarters: Goslar, Lower Saxony, Germany
Key Offering: Nano-tungsten powders, high-density alloys powders

H.C. Starck is renowned for its cutting-edge tungsten powders used in medical imaging equipment and fusion energy research. Their focus on nanotechnology has positioned them at the forefront of applications requiring extreme density and thermal conductivity. As Europe pushes for tech sovereignty, the company benefits from EU funding for critical raw materials development.

Sustainability and Innovation Initiatives:

  • Certification under EU Conflict Minerals Regulation for ethical sourcing

  • R&D into tungsten for hydrogen fuel cells, targeting net-zero goals

  • Current production capacity: Over 5,000 tons/year of specialty powders

🌍 Outlook: The Future of Tungsten Metal Powder Is Innovative and Sustainable

The tungsten metal powder market is undergoing a dynamic shift. While traditional cemented carbide applications still dominate in volume, the industry is investing heavily in nano-scale powders, recycling technologies, and sustainable extraction methods to address supply constraints and environmental concerns. As emerging economies industrialize and advanced tech sectors expand, demand is set to surge, prompting producers to innovate in particle engineering and global logistics.

📈 Key Trends Shaping the Market:

  • Rapid expansion of ultra-fine powder production for 3D printing and electronics in Asia-Pacific and North America

  • Regulatory mandates for recycled content in critical materials, aiming for 15-25% by 2030 in EU and U.S. policies

  • Digitalization of supply chains with blockchain for traceability and IoT for quality control

  • Strategic alliances between miners, processors, and end-users to accelerate R&D in high-performance alloys
